2022 Tacoma Studio Tour
Call to Artists!
The deadline for this application is Tuesday, May 31, 2022, at 11:59 pm.
Hello, Artists and Creatives!
Are you a creative or an artist that lives in and has a working studio and/or a performance space in Tacoma? Help us advance the visibility of arts and culture in Tacoma by applying to participate in our 19th annual Tacoma Studio Tour! The Tacoma Studio Tour is an exciting opportunity to invite the public in to your working studio or performance space, give demonstrations of how you make your work, or host a hands-on or interactive activity with the community!
Studios will be open on Saturday, October 15th and Sunday, October 16th from 11 am to 5 pm. You can choose to be open on Saturday, Sunday, or both days. There is no fee to apply and/or participate in the Tacoma Studio Tour.
Read the full call to artists and apply at www.cityoftacoma.org/artsopps.
Eligibility:
You must live within the Tacoma city limits and/or your working studio must be located within the Tacoma city limits
Your work must be created, performed, and/or handmade by you; not commercially acquired and/or appropriated
You must provide a demonstration of your art form and/or provide a hands-on or interactive activity for attendees
You must actively promote the Studio Tour to your own contacts (the Tacoma Arts Commission will provide some electronic and print publicity materials that you are encouraged to use).
Creatives and artists who identify as members of the Global Majority, Black, Brown, Indigenous, People of Color (BBIPOC), African, Latinx, Arab, Asian, Native-American (ALAANA) communities; economically or socio-economically marginalized communities; LGBTQIA+ communities, and people living with disabilities are strongly encouraged to apply.
